Why the Odds Are Always a Conversation Starter

Let’s be honest: the house always has an edge. It’s the oldest trick in the book, yet players often overlook the subtle ways odds are stacked. Think of it like a poker game where the dealer knows your hand but you don’t. That’s not to say you can’t win, but expecting to beat the system consistently is like trying to out-bluff a seasoned shark at the table.

Understanding the return to player (RTP) percentages is crucial, but even those numbers can be misleading. Some games flaunt RTPs north of 97%, yet the volatility can turn your bankroll into a rollercoaster ride. High RTP doesn’t guarantee a payday; it just means the game theoretically pays back more over an eternity of spins—something most of us don’t have.

Bonuses: Sweet Treats or Traps in Disguise?

Ah, bonuses—the siren call of online casinos. They dangle free spins and deposit matches like candy, but the fine print often reads like a legal thriller. Wagering requirements can turn a “free” bonus into a wild goose chase, where you’re chasing your tail trying to meet conditions that make cashing out feel like winning the lottery twice.

It’s worth approaching bonuses with a healthy dose of skepticism. Sometimes, the best strategy is to play without them and avoid the headache of complicated terms. If you do decide to chase the bonus dragon, make sure you understand the rules, or you might find yourself locked into a game of catch-me-if-you-can with your own money.

Security and Fair Play: The Invisible Guardians

Behind the glitz, the real MVPs are the security protocols and fairness audits. Licensed casinos undergo rigorous testing by independent bodies to ensure games aren’t rigged and player data is locked down tighter than Fort Knox. Without these safeguards, you’re basically handing your cash to a digital street hustler.

Key Security Features to Look For
Feature Purpose What It Means for You
SSL Encryption Protects data transmission Your personal and financial info stays private
Random Number Generator (RNG) Certification Ensures game outcomes are random Games aren’t rigged against you
Licensing Authority Regulates casino operations Legal oversight and dispute resolution
Responsible Gambling Tools Helps manage betting behavior Prevents problem gambling
